Another "blowing myself up" story
Just to join in with the current theme:

As a lad, 12 years old or so, I wanted to build model rockets, but such things were illegal in the UK. So like many others here, it seems, I improvised: stripping firework rockets down to the bare motors, and building models to fly with them. This naturally left lots of stars and other pyrotechnic effects left over.

So this one time I was working on a fuse, but my lighter was nearly dying. So I grabbed an empty plastic tub to act as a draught-shield. Unfortunately, the tub I grabbed, stuck my hand into and flicked the lighter in turned out to be full of coloured stars, which promptly went up, removing my eyebrows and much of the top layer of skin on my hand, and filling the house with acrid smoke.

Just as I was reeling from that, my folks called me into the front room because the film we had previously arranged to watch together was starting. So I had to watch the whole thing pretending that I hadn't just set fire to my hand, not reacting in any way to the pain.

I did go on to build working model rockets. Then I got a girlfriend and lost interest. Now I'm long-married, I'm thinking of taking it up again...
